THIS IS AN ACTUAL SCAM EMAIL - DO NOT REPLY TO THE SENDER UNLESS YOU KNOW WHAT YOU'RE DOING

 

Subject: Shipment
From:mo1usman@yahoo.com
Date:Thu, 10 Sep 2009 18:30:59 +0200
   
Message body: From The Desk Of
Alhaji Mohammed Usman
Union Bank Vault/Security warehouse of Nigeria.

Attn: Consignor,

This is to inform you that arrangements have been concluded as regards to
the shipment of your consignment of funds to your country. I choose to
conclude it and make sure it is off already before contacting you. I found
out that this consignment has been lying here because of non-payment of
shipment fees. This is why I decided to use my discretion as the Shipment
officer in charge of the Union Bank Vault/Security warehouse of Nigeria.
(This is where all the abandoned consignments and Master Cards from Union
Bank are kept at the orders of the Government of Nigeria.)

The consignment has left Lagos Nigeria yesterday night en-route via
London/ USA. It is a metal box, silver in color with a weight of about
110kg approximately, the box is declared as containing delivery/Bank
Documents only. Call me immediately so that I can give you the name, phone
and fax numbers of the company that is in changer in USA so that you
confirm when the consignment will arrive.

Warning!: The content of the consignment is Money but declared Bank
Documents to avoid diversion by the delivery Agent. I have the Combination
Keys to open the Cash Consignment. Once you establish contact with the
Delivery Agent l will release the Combination keys to open the Consignment
to you. Please do not disclose the content of the Consignment to the
Delivery agent to avoid diversion. You must also know that this
arrangement does not concern all the people you were dealing with.

Waiting for your call

Alhaji Mohammed Umar
Union Bank Vault/Security warehouse of Nigeria.
